Over the past several weeks we have been calling for a shallow correction for stocks and that is exactly what we are getting.  Many believe, us included, that this type of action is healthy as the stock market has come very far very fast.  We also believe that ultimately, perhaps after two or three more months of this breather, the  market will ultimately move up as stimulus money appropriated by congress actually makes its way into the economy.  With this in mind, we would use this sideways action to review your current investment objectives, your tolerance to risk and what funds you will be using to help you reach your objectives.
